This is the road leading to the Cape Willoughby Lighthouse, Kangaroo Island, South Australia. The cape is the site of South Australia’s first lighthouse which was first illuminated on 16 January 1852

Travel Information

It is about a 30 min drive mostly dirt and a bit rough depending on when it has been maintained. There is accommodation in the Lighthouse buildings. need to be booked online
